The short answer
1am in Eastern European Time is 12am in Rome.
Eastern European Time is 1 hour ahead of Rome. It lands deep outside working hours in Rome — see the best time to meet below for a friendlier slot.

- What is the time difference between Eastern European Time and Rome?
- Eastern European Time is 1 hour ahead of Rome right now. We always show the live, daylight-saving-correct difference, so this figure already accounts for whichever side is observing summer time today.
- When it's 1am in Eastern European Time, what time is it in Rome?
- 1am in Eastern European Time is 12am in Rome. It lands deep outside working hours in Rome — see the best time to meet below for a friendlier slot. Use the hour-by-hour table above to read any other time across.
- What's the best time for a call between Eastern European Time and Rome?
- 10am–5pm in Eastern European Time lines up with 9am–4pm in Rome — both sides are inside a 9-to-5 working day.
- Does this account for daylight saving time?
- Yes. We track every clock change in both places, so the abbreviations you see — EEST and CEST — are the ones actually in effect right now, not a fixed all-year value. When either side changes its clocks, this page updates automatically.
- Why is the date sometimes different on each side?
- When two places are far enough apart, the same moment can fall on different calendar days. That is why some conversions are marked "previous day" or "next day" — it is the same instant in time, read off two clocks that crossed midnight at different points.
